Modulate a sine wave after quantizing it

Help! I am trying to modulate a sine wave after quantizing it, but keep getting an error. =================================
t = [0:.1:2*pi]; % Times at which to sample the sine function
sig = sin(t); % Original signal, a sine wave
partition = [-1:2/15:1]; % Length 15, to represent 16 intervals
codebook = [-1.2:2/15:1]; % Length 16, one entry for each interval
[index,quants] = quantiz(sig,partition,codebook); % Quantize.
plot(t,sig,'x',t,quants,'.')
legend('Original signal','Quantized signal');
axis([-.2 7 -1.2 1.2])
M=16;
y=qammod(quants,M)
==============
??? Error using ==> qammod at 39
Elements of input X must be integers in the range [0, M-1].
>>
I checked the max and min value of quants and found it to be:
>> max(quants)= 0.8000
>> min(quants)= -1
Is there some way i can scale quants so I get in the specified range?
